Do you know?
A Social Exchange Platform (SEP) operator, the company running the fundraising platform, must have RM500,000 minimum paid-up share capital and maintain RM500,000 shareholdersā funds at all times. Non-profit organisations using the platform must meet other eligibility and reporting rules but face no capital requirements.
